Abstract:
By using the g loba l equ ilibrium design ideo logy of orthogonal exper imentm e thod, the paper proposes a g enetic a lgor ithm w ith mu lt-i po int orthogona l crossover ope ration. C rossover ope ration o f the algorithm is based on the orthogona l array, and the tw o ofm any o ffspr ing that hav e b igger fitness are cho sen to put in nex t evo lution. The a lgorithm can ensure population mu ltifo rm ity and converg ence speed rapidly. The research results show tha t the a lgo rithm can no t on ly ove rcom e the shortcom ings o f SGA e ffective ly, but a lso ev idently improve the com puting speed, com puting prec ision and computing stab ility.
